Medical Imaging Provider Information

About The physicians of Florida Radiation Oncology are proud to be leaders in curative and palliative radiation oncology care using a comprehensive range of state-of-the-art technologies.

Cancer Treatment: They will coordinate your care with the other members of your treatment team to provide you with the best and most personalized care. As an independent facility, they are able to work with ALL of the physicians throughout the community, regardless of those practitioners’ hospital affiliations or practice locations.

Radiation Oncology Technology: They have invested in the best and most advanced equipment to provide their patients with cutting edge treatment technologies, including Stereotactic Radiosurgery (SRS), Stereotactic Radiotherapy (SRT), Stereotactic Body Radiotherapy (SBRT/SABR), Image Guided Radiotherapy (IGRT), and High Dose Rate (HDR) Brachytherapy.

Key Doctors: Dr. David A. Diamond, MD, FACRO, Medical Director and Board Certified Radiation Oncologist, and Dr. Kelly E. LaFave, MD, DABR, Medical Director and Board Certified Radiation Oncologist.

Learn more about Release of Information

Release of Information (ROI) in healthcare refers to the process by which patient health information is disclosed to authorized individuals or entities. This process ensures that sensitive health data is shared securely and in compliance with legal and regulatory standards. ROI can occur for various reasons, such as continuity of care, billing purposes, legal requests, or patient transfers.
